Development of World’s First High-Speed Standard Zoom with Built-in Vibration Compensation by TAMRON
Tamron has announced the introduction of world’s first full-size, high speed standard zoom with built-in image stabilization as well as Ultrasonic Silent Drive (USD). The new SP 24-70mm F/2.8 Di VC USD (Model A007) uses a specialized high grade glass in the three LD elements, three Glass Molded Aspherical Lenses, one Hybrid Aspherical Lens and two XR (Extra Refractive Index) glasses, plus it comes with rounded diaphragm, resulting in top of the class blur effects. Development of Vari-Focal Lens with Motorized Zoom and Bipolar Drive Stepper Motor for Fine Tuning of the Iris
Tamron has announced the development of a 1/3 inch 3.0-9mm F/1.2 P-iris vari-focal lens for integrated cameras equipped with motorized zoom and focus, capable of mega-pixel resolutions and infrared. The new DF010QA3 lens incorporates bipolar drive stepper motor for fine tuning the iris. This will allow the lens to adjust the aperture to a position that does not cause diffraction, enabling an appropriate exposure level by utilizing the camera shutter speed. Read more
Release of a New High-Power Zoom Lens for Sony Mirrorless Interchangeable Lens Camera Series
Tamron has released a new 18-200mm F/3.5-6.3 Di III VC, designed specifically for Sony’s mirrorless interchangeable lens camera series. This compact and light weight zoom lens weighs 460 grams with 62mm filter equipped with Tamron’s Vibration Compensation (VC) for easy photo shooting from 18mm wide angle to 200mm full telephoto. It features stepping motor adopted for AF drive providing contrast detection AF and shooting video. Read more
Release of 1/3”-Format 2.8-8mm F/1.2 Mega Pixel Vari-Focal Lens with P-Iris by Tamron
Tamron has announced the release of a new P-Iris Mega-Pixel Vari-focal lens capable of delivering full high-definition 1080p images over entire focal length range. The new M13VP288IR is compatible with 3 Mega-Pixel Day/Night cameras. The new Lens is equipped with a bipolar drive stepper motor which allows fine iris control to suit any environment. The lens offers a wide horizontal angle of view-100.1 degrees making it possible to cover the entire room when positioning the camera in a corner of the room. The new lens provides clear images by minimizing chromatic aberration. The new M13VP288IR lens is designed to fit any camera by reducing the amount of protrusion of the rear element from the lens mount in preventing interference with components within camera.

Release of “Panorama Camera 180-View”, Fish-eye lens equipped Security Camera by TAMRON
Tamron has announced the release of “Panorama Camera 180-View”, a new type of security camera equipped with fish-eye lens capable of delivering a 180 degrees horizontal angle of view whereby eliminating any blind spots. Typically, in order to provide an adequate coverage in areas with high security requirements, several security cameras are installed to overcome the blind spot problems. This issue can not be overcome through use of speed dome cameras due to their inherent deficiency in capturing subject instantaneously. Tamron has solved this issue with their newly developed “Panorama Camera 180-View”, thanks to its fish-eye lens capable of delivering a 180 degrees horizontal angle of view, allowing its single camera to capture images free of blind spots. Development of Far-Infrared High-Sensitivity Security Camera and High-Performance Interchangeable Lenses
Far-Infrared (far-IR) cameras for their ability in screening pandemics of infectious diseases have been gaining attention in recent years. Taking advantage of their inherent longer wavelength than visible spectrum infrared sensors is capable of detecting heat and creating images of objects and phenomena that would be impossible to film using a normal-view camera, by minimizing the impact of no lighting at night or obstructing objects such as fog, boosting the marketability of far-IR cameras for security and surveillance applications, where there is an increased needs for improved image recognition. Based on this, Tamron a leading Japanese manufacturer in optical products and security market and NEC Avio Infrared Technologies, leading infrared technology device companies in Japan have jointly developed a new far-IR high sensitivity camera and a series of six high performance interchangeable lenses for use in security applications. TAMRON Introduces the World’s Most Compact and Light Weight 15x Zoom Lens
Tamron announced the release of 18-270mm F/3.5-6.3 Di II VC PZD (Piezo Drive), the world’s most smallest and lightest 15x zoom ratio lens, featuring a 62mm filter diameter, VC (Vibration Compensation) image stabilization and company’s first standing wave ultrasonic motor system for SLR lenses, plus a Piezo Drive (PZD).The new lens (model B008) measures only 88mm in length and it weighs only 450 gram. The new PZD offers the user silent, high-speed auto focus, with minimum focusing distance of 0.49m throughout the zoom range and a maximum magnification ratio of 1:3.8. Read more
